Ski jumping: 11th World Cup victory for Eva Pinkelnig

Eva Pinkelnig won.

The Vorarlberg native won on the large hill with 195.7 points and jumps of 115.5 and 119.5 m, 2.4 points ahead of the Finn Jenny Rautionaho and 3.2 points ahead of Eirin Maria Kvandal (NOR). For Pinkelnig, who only joined at the end of December, it was the second win of the season after Oberstdorf.

Season dominator Nika Prevc, who had led after the first round, completely botched her final jump. The Slovenian was passed through to tenth place after the 96 m jump. Pinkelnig and Kvandal were ex aequo second after the first round.

Jacqueline Seifriedsberger was the second best ÖSV jumper in eighth place, Sara Marita Kramer was eleventh, Chiara Kreuzer was 13th and Julia Mühlbacher was 16th. Lisa Eder also scored World Cup points in 29th place.
